Mc2 Saint Barth
MC2 Saint Barth Cate logo-detail shorts - Blue
£98£83(10% off)
MC2 Saint Barth wave-textured shorts - Neutrals
£203£182(10% off)
MC2 Saint Barth striped shorts - Green
£152£110(17% off)
MC2 Saint Barth Meave paisley-print linen shorts - White
£198
MC2 Saint Barth bandana-print denim shorts - Neutrals
£158£150(5% off)
MC2 Saint Barth Azure cable-knit shorts - Neutrals
£143£121(15% off)
MC2 Saint Barth Meave shorts - White
£149£100(10% off)
MC2 Saint Barth Meave shorts - Neutrals
£146